Integrated all-drug robot intelligent pharmacy and method of using the same

ActiveCN119873186BImprove pick-and-place efficiencyimprove accuracyStorage devicesConveyor partsPharmacyDispensary
The application discloses an integrated full-medicine robot intelligent pharmacy and a use method thereof. The intelligent pharmacy comprises a pharmacy body, a medicine shelf for placing medicines is arranged in the pharmacy body, a plurality of medicine storage baskets are placed on the medicine shelf, an X-axis transmission device moving along an X direction is arranged on one side of the medicine shelf, a Z-axis transmission device is vertically slidably arranged on the X-axis transmission device, a medicine taking and storing device and an electric mechanical hand are arranged on the Z-axis transmission device, a scanning mechanism for identifying the traceability code of the medicines in the medicine storage baskets is arranged on the medicine taking and storing device, a medicine supplementing device and a first medicine dispensing device are further arranged in the pharmacy body, and a second medicine dispensing device is arranged in communication with the outside of the pharmacy body. The electric mechanical hand, the medicine taking and storing device are driven by the X-axis transmission device and the Z-axis transmission device to move to the medicine shelf to take and place the medicines, and the first medicine dispensing device, the second medicine dispensing device and the medicine supplementing device are cooperated to realize automatic identification, dispensing and supplementing of the full medicines, so that the phenomenon of medicine clamping and medicine taking error is avoided.

Automatic counting, checking and collecting device

ActiveCN224190509UImprove counting efficiencyImprove Counting AccuracyCounting mechanisms/objectsComputer hardwareElectric machinery
An automatic counting, checking and collecting device comprises a supporting frame, a material distributing disc is fixed to the supporting frame, a rotating disc is arranged on the material distributing disc, a plurality of fan-shaped grooves with the same size are formed in the rotating disc, a plurality of containing holes used for containing products are formed in the fan-shaped grooves, the containing holes penetrate through the fan-shaped grooves, and the rotating disc is arranged on the supporting frame. A fan-shaped blanking hole corresponding to the fan-shaped groove is formed in the material distributing disc, a driving assembly for driving the rotating disc to rotate is arranged below the rotating disc, and a camera for scanning the number of products is further arranged above the rotating disc; the driving motor drives the rotating disc to improve the counting efficiency and accuracy, the counting scheme that the circular rotating disc tool is combined with the groove is matched with the camera for automatic scanning confirmation, the problems that manual counting is prone to fatigue and inattention are effectively solved, it is ensured that the counting result is accurate, and meanwhile the labor cost and the labor intensity can be reduced.

A greenhouse armyworm plate pest image acquisition and identification method based on deep learning

PendingCN122347817AImprove recognition accuracyImprove Counting AccuracyPattern recognitionImaging processing
The application provides a greenhouse armyworm plate pest image acquisition and identification method based on deep learning, and belongs to the technical field of image processing. The method comprises the following steps: obtaining an armyworm plate image through a field acquisition device; performing a pretreatment operation on each initial armyworm plate image to obtain a plurality of sample armyworm plate images; inputting the plurality of sample armyworm plate images into an initial pest detection model, generating a candidate region by using a region proposal network, performing pooling and classification regression on each candidate region to obtain sample pest type and sample pest position information; calculating a region proposal network loss and a classification regression network loss according to the sample pest type and the sample pest position information, and determining total loss information according to the region proposal network loss and the classification regression network loss; inputting a to-be-detected armyworm plate image into a target pest detection model, sequentially passing through a region proposal network and a classification regression network to obtain target pest type and target pest position information.

A food packaging counting machine

ActiveCN224632092UFiltration effect remains stableReduce failure
This utility model relates to the field of food packaging technology, and in particular to a food packaging counting machine, comprising four support rods. Each of the four support rods has an anti-slip pad fixedly connected to its lower end. The upper ends of the two front support rods are jointly fixedly connected to a first machine body, and the upper ends of the two rear support rods are jointly fixedly connected to a second machine body. The rear end of the first machine body and the front end of the second machine body are fixedly connected. A filter assembly is inserted and connected to the upper part of the front end of the first machine body. This food packaging counting machine, through the combination of an inclined collection chamber and a single-particle channel, achieves smooth material conveying. Combined with a counting photoelectric sensor, it senses and counts each passing particle, transmitting the data to the control system in real time. This reduces material accumulation and jamming during conveying, improves counting efficiency, ensures counting accuracy, and reduces packaging rework rates.

Double-turntable high-speed multinational coin mixed counting machine

The utility model discloses a double-turntable high-speed multinational coin mixed-point counting machine, which mainly comprises a counting machine main body, an operation table, a coin conveying hopper, a main turntable, a coin climbing belt, a multi-slideway coin separating plate, a counterfeit detection sensor and the like. Coins of different specifications enter corresponding slideways in the coin separating plate, fall into a coin bin after being screened by an active coin kicking electromagnet, and are subjected to authenticity detection by an authenticity detection sensor, so that accurate counting is ensured, a double-turntable structure is adopted by the counting machine, a coin conveying and separating system is optimized, the counting speed is greatly increased, and the counting efficiency is improved. The coin counting device can meet the requirement for rapid mixed-point counting of a large number of coins, has the capacity of classifying and processing coins of multiple counts, is reasonable in structure and easy and convenient to operate and maintain, and effectively improves the efficiency and accuracy of coin counting work.

Control method, device and readable storage medium of winding machine

The application discloses a control method and device of a winding machine and a readable storage medium, and relates to the technical field of equipment control. The control method of the winding machine comprises the following steps: before the winding machine performs coil winding on an iron core, determining a first winding turn number corresponding to the iron core; according to the first winding turn number, determining a second winding turn number corresponding to the iron core, wherein the second winding turn number is smaller than the first winding turn number; in the process of controlling the winding motor to drive the iron core to rotate at a first rotating speed to perform coil winding on the iron core, detecting the number of coils wound on the iron core by controlling a counter and a photoelectric switch; under the condition that the number of coils wound on the iron core is greater than or equal to the second winding turn number, controlling the winding motor to drive the iron core to rotate at a second rotating speed, wherein the second rotating speed is smaller than the first rotating speed; and under the condition that the number of coils wound on the iron core is greater than or equal to the first winding turn number, controlling the winding motor to stop working. The application improves the production efficiency of the winding machine.

A method and system for transient classification processing of nuclear power units

ActiveCN116341318BImprove transient classificationImprove counting efficiencyNuclear energy generationDesign optimisation/simulation
This invention discloses a transient classification and processing method and system for nuclear power units. It performs initial classification of transients generated by nuclear power units, and conducts secondary discrimination for transients that cannot be classified into the corresponding category. For unclassified transients, it provides classification suggestions for design transients. If the alternating stress intensity of each key component is less than the corresponding material fatigue limit, the unclassified transient is classified as a suggested design transient. Otherwise, further judgment is needed for the key components that do not meet the conditions. If the fatigue service factor caused by the unclassified transient is less than the fatigue service factor caused by the suggested design transient, the unclassified transient is classified as a suggested design transient. The transient classification and processing method and system provided by this invention classifies unclassifiable operational transients by evaluating the fatigue damage to mechanical components caused by the transient, greatly improving the efficiency of current transient classification and counting.
